#f5a491 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f5a491 is composed of 96.1% red, 64.3%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.1% magenta, 40.8%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 11.4 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 76.5%. #f5a491 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eb4923.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

Shades and Tints of #f5a491

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100401 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f5a491

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c7c1bf is the less saturated color, while #fe9e88 is the most saturated one.
